The Oxford History of Music Volume 1: The Polyphonic Period, Part One: Method of Musical Art 330-1330 (1901) is a comprehensive book written by H. E. Wooldridge. The book provides an in-depth exploration of the development of music during the Polyphonic Period, focusing on the period between 330 and 1330. The author examines the various techniques and methods used by musicians during this time, as well as the cultural and historical context in which they developed.The book is divided into several chapters, each of which focuses on a specific aspect of music during the Polyphonic Period. The author begins by providing an overview of the period and its significance in the history of music. He then goes on to explore the various forms of polyphonic music that developed during this time, including plainchant, organum, and motet.The author also examines the role of musical notation during this period, as well as the various instruments that were used to create and perform music. He provides detailed information on the development of musical theory, including the use of modes and the development of polyphony.Throughout the book, the author provides numerous examples of music from the Polyphonic Period, including transcriptions of plainchant and other forms of polyphonic music. He also includes a number of illustrations and diagrams to help readers better understand the various techniques and methods used by musicians during this time.Overall, The Oxford History of Music Volume 1: The Polyphonic Period, Part One: Method of Musical Art 330-1330 (1901) is an essential resource for anyone interested in the history of music.
